Towards Efficient Implementation of XML Schema Content Models

Pekka Kilpeläinen, Rauno Tuhkanen

Citation
Descriptions
Abstract:

XML Schema uses an extension of traditional regular expressions for describing allowed contents of document elements. Iteration is described through numeric attributes minOccurs and maxOccurs attached to content-describing elements such as sequence, choice, and element. These numeric occurrence indicators are a challenge to standard automata-based solutions. Straightforward solutions require space that is exponential with respect to the length of the expressions. We describe a strategy to implement unambiguous content model expressions as counter automata, which are of linear size only.

Resources

Bibliography Navigation: Reference List; Author Index; Title Index; Keyword Index


Generated by sharef2html on 2011-04-15, 02:00:41.